<?php
namespace StubsGenerator;
use PhpParser\Node;
use PhpParser\Node\Expr\ArrayDimFetch;
use PhpParser\Node\Expr\Assign;
use PhpParser\Node\Expr\ConstFetch;
use PhpParser\Node\Expr\FuncCall;
use PhpParser\Node\Expr\Variable;
use PhpParser\Node\Name;
use PhpParser\Node\Scalar\String_;
use PhpParser\Node\Stmt;
use PhpParser\Node\Stmt\Class_;
use PhpParser\Node\Stmt\ClassConst;
use PhpParser\Node\Stmt\ClassLike;
use PhpParser\Node\Stmt\ClassMethod;
use PhpParser\Node\Stmt\Const_;
use PhpParser\Node\Stmt\Expression;
use PhpParser\Node\Stmt\Function_;
use PhpParser\Node\Stmt\If_;
use PhpParser\Node\Stmt\Interface_;
use PhpParser\Node\Stmt\Namespace_;
use PhpParser\Node\Stmt\Property;
use PhpParser\Node\Stmt\Trait_;
use PhpParser\NodeTraverser;
use PhpParser\NodeVisitorAbstract;
/**
* On node traversal, this visitor converts any AST to one just containing stub
* definitions, removing anything uninteresting.
*
* @internal
*/
class NodeVisitor extends NodeVisitorAbstract
{
/** @var bool */
private $needsFunctions;
/** @var bool */
private $needsClasses;
/** @var bool */
private $needsTraits;
/** @var bool */
private $needsInterfaces;
/** @var bool */
private $needsDocumentedGlobals;
/** @var bool */
private $needsUndocumentedGlobals;
/** @var bool */
private $needsConstants;
/** @var bool */
private $nullifyGlobals;
/** @var bool */
private $includeInaccessibleClassNodes;
/**
* @psalm-suppress PropertyNotSetInConstructor
* @var Node[]
*/
protected $stack;
/** @var Namespace_[] */
private $namespaces = [];
/** @var Namespace_ */
private $globalNamespace;
/** @var Node[] */
private $globalExpressions = [];
/** @var ClassLikeWithDependencies[] */
private $classLikes = [];
/** @var true[] */
private $resolvedClassLikes = [];
/** @var Namespace_[] */
private $classLikeNamespaces = [];
/** @var Namespace_|null */
private $currentClassLikeNamespace = null;
/** @var bool */
private $isInDeclaration = false;
/** @var bool */
private $isInIf = false;
/**
* @var int[][]
* @psalm-var array<string, array<string, int>>
*/
private $counts = [
'functions' => [],
'classes' => [],
'interfaces' => [],
'traits' => [],
'constants' => [],
'globals' => [],
];
/**
* @param int $symbols Set of symbol types to include stubs for.
*/
public function init(int $symbols = StubsGenerator::DEFAULT, array $config = [])
{
$this->needsFunctions = ($symbols & StubsGenerator::FUNCTIONS) !== 0;
$this->needsClasses = ($symbols & StubsGenerator::CLASSES) !== 0;
$this->needsTraits = ($symbols & StubsGenerator::TRAITS) !== 0;
$this->needsInterfaces = ($symbols & StubsGenerator::INTERFACES) !== 0;
$this->needsDocumentedGlobals = ($symbols & StubsGenerator::DOCUMENTED_GLOBALS) !== 0;
$this->needsUndocumentedGlobals = ($symbols & StubsGenerator::UNDOCUMENTED_GLOBALS) !== 0;
$this->needsConstants = ($symbols & StubsGenerator::CONSTANTS) !== 0;
$this->nullifyGlobals = !empty($config['nullify_globals']);
$this->includeInaccessibleClassNodes = ($config['include_inaccessible_class_nodes'] ?? false) === true;
$this->globalNamespace = new Namespace_();
}
public function beforeTraverse(array $nodes)
{
$this->stack = [];
}
public function enterNode(Node $node)
{
$this->stack[] = $node;
if ($node instanceof Namespace_) {
// We always need to parse the children of namespaces.
return;
}
if (($this->needsClasses && $node instanceof Class_)
|| ($this->needsInterfaces && $node instanceof Interface_)
|| ($this->needsTraits && $node instanceof Trait_)
) {
// We'll need to parse all descendents of these nodes (if we plan to
// include them in the stubs at all) so we get method, property, and
// constant declarations.
$this->isInDeclaration = true;
} elseif ($node instanceof Function_ || $node instanceof ClassMethod) {
// We can just delete function or method bodies for our stubs. In
// the future we may want to parse them for constant definitions or
// the like.
if ($node->stmts) {
$node->stmts = [];
}
// We need to parse all the (non-statement) descendents of these
// nodes so that constant or class references in the function
// signatures are fully qualified by the `NameResolver` visitor.
// (This will already be `true` if it's a ClassMethod.)
$this->isInDeclaration = true;
} elseif ($node instanceof Expression
&& $node->expr instanceof Assign
) {
// Since we don't parse any the bodies of any statements which can
// hold variable assignments---other than namespaces---we know these
// assigns are for globals. Check if we are assigning to `$GLOBALS`
// with a simple string that's a valid variable identifier. If so,
// convert it to a normal variable assignment.
if (count($this->stack) === 1
&& $node->expr->var instanceof ArrayDimFetch
&& $node->expr->var->var instanceof Variable
&& $node->expr->var->var->name === 'GLOBALS'
&& $node->expr->var->dim instanceof String_
&& preg_match('/^[a-zA-Z_][a-zA-Z0-9_]*$/', $node->expr->var->dim->value)
) {
$node->expr->var = new Variable($node->expr->var->dim->value);
}
// Ensure that class or constant references are fully qualified.
$this->isInDeclaration = true;
if ($this->nullifyGlobals) {
$node->expr->expr = new ConstFetch(new Name('null'));
}
} elseif ($node instanceof Const_) {
$this->isInDeclaration = true;
} elseif (
$node instanceof Expression &&
$node->expr instanceof FuncCall &&
$node->expr->name instanceof Name &&
$node->expr->name->parts[0] === 'define'
) {
$this->isInDeclaration = true;
} elseif ($node instanceof If_) {
if (!$this->isInIf) {
// We'll examine the first level inside of an if statement to
// look for function/class/etc. declarations.
$this->isInIf = true;
return; // Traverse children.
}
}
if (!$this->isInDeclaration) {
// Don't bother parsing descendents of uninteresting nodes.
return NodeTraverser::DONT_TRAVERSE_CHILDREN;
}
}
public function leaveNode(Node $node, bool $preserveStack = false)
{
if (!$preserveStack) {
array_pop($this->stack);
}
$parent = $this->stack[count($this->stack) - 1] ?? null;
if (($node instanceof Expression && $node->expr instanceof Assign)
|| $node instanceof Function_
|| $node instanceof Class_
|| $node instanceof Interface_
|| $node instanceof Trait_
|| $node instanceof Const_
|| (
$node instanceof Expression &&
$node->expr instanceof FuncCall &&
$node->expr->name instanceof Name &&
$node->expr->name->parts[0] === 'define'
)
) {
// We're leaving one of these.
$this->isInDeclaration = false;
}
if ($node instanceof If_) {
// Replace the if statement with its set of children, but only those
// that we want. Have to manually call leaveNode on each; it won't
// be called automatically..
$stmts = [];
foreach ($node->stmts as $stmt) {
if ($this->leaveNode($stmt, true) !== NodeTraverser::REMOVE_NODE) {
$stmt = $stmt;
}
}
// We're leaving it.
$this->isInIf = false;
return $stmts;
}
if ($node instanceof Namespace_) {
$this->namespaces[] = $node;
return;
}
if ($node instanceof Name) {
// Can't delete namespace names!
return;
}
if ($parent && !($parent instanceof Namespace_)) {
// Implies `$parent instanceof ClassLike`, which means $node is a
// either a method, property, or constant, or its part of the
// declaration itself (e.g., `extends`).
if (!$this->includeInaccessibleClassNodes
&& $parent instanceof Class_
&& ($node instanceof ClassMethod || $node instanceof ClassConst || $node instanceof Property)
&& ($node->isPrivate() || $node->isProtected())
) {
return NodeTraverser::REMOVE_NODE;
}
return;
}
$namespaceName = ($parent && $parent->name) ? $parent->name->toString() : '';
if ($this->needsNode($node, $namespaceName)) {
if ($node instanceof ClassLike) {
// Ignore anonymous classes.
if ($node->name) {
$clwd = new ClassLikeWithDependencies($node, $namespaceName);
$this->classLikes[$clwd->fullyQualifiedName] = $clwd;
}
} elseif ($parent) {
// If we're here, `$parent` is a namespace. Let's just keep the
// `$node` around in `$parent->stmts`.
return; // Don't remove.
} elseif ($node instanceof Stmt) {
// Anything other than a namespace which doesn't have a parent
// node must belong in the global namespace. We can still remove
// the `$node` from the current list of statements since we're
// stashing it for later no matter what.
$this->globalNamespace->stmts[] = $node;
} else {
// Technically only statements should be added to the global
// namespace; that said, these will be bundled in with the
// global namespace when the code is generated anyway.
$this->globalExpressions[] = $node;
}
}
// Any other top level junk we are happy to remove.
return NodeTraverser::REMOVE_NODE;
}
public function afterTraverse(array $nodes)
{
// Don't keep any empty namespaces.
$this->namespaces = array_filter($this->namespaces, function (Namespace_ $ns): bool {
return (bool) $ns->stmts;
});
}
/**
* Returns the stored set of stub nodes which are built up during traversal.
*
* @return Node[]
*/
public function getStubStmts(): array
{
foreach ($this->classLikes as $classLike) {
$this->resolveClassLike($classLike);
}
if ($this->allAreGlobal($this->namespaces) && $this->allAreGlobal($this->classLikeNamespaces)) {
return array_merge(
$this->reduceStmts($this->classLikeNamespaces),
$this->reduceStmts($this->namespaces),
$this->globalNamespace->stmts,
$this->globalExpressions
);
}
return array_merge(
$this->classLikeNamespaces,
$this->namespaces,
$this->globalNamespace->stmts ? [$this->globalNamespace] : [],
$this->globalExpressions ? [new Namespace_(null, $this->globalExpressions)] : []
);
}
/**
* Returns the counts of all symbols included in the stubs, grouped by type.
*
* These counts are built up during traveral.
*
* @psalm-return array<string, array<string, int>>
*/
public function getCounts(): array
{
return $this->counts;
}
/**
* Determines if we should keep the given `$node` in `$this->leaveNode()`.
*
* @param Node $node
* @param string $namespace The namespace we're in.
*
* @return bool
*/
private function needsNode(Node $node, string $namespace): bool
{
$fullyQualifiedName = ($node instanceof Function_ || $node instanceof ClassLike)
? '\\' . ltrim("{$namespace}\\{$node->name}", '\\')
: '';
if ($node instanceof Function_) {
return $this->needsFunctions
&& $this->count('functions', $fullyQualifiedName)
&& !function_exists($fullyQualifiedName);
}
if ($node instanceof Class_) {
return $this->needsClasses
&& $this->count('classes', $fullyQualifiedName)
&& !class_exists($fullyQualifiedName);
}
if ($node instanceof Interface_) {
return $this->needsInterfaces
&& $this->count('interfaces', $fullyQualifiedName)
&& !interface_exists($fullyQualifiedName);
}
if ($node instanceof Trait_) {
return $this->needsTraits
&& $this->count('traits', $fullyQualifiedName)
&& !trait_exists($fullyQualifiedName);
}
if ($this->needsConstants) {
if ($node instanceof Const_) {
$node->consts = \array_filter(
$node->consts,
function (\PhpParser\Node\Const_ $const) {
$fullyQualifiedName = $const->name->name;
return $this->count('constants', $fullyQualifiedName)
&& !defined($fullyQualifiedName);
}
);
return count($node->consts) > 0;
}
if (
$node instanceof Expression &&
$node->expr instanceof FuncCall &&
$node->expr->name instanceof Name &&
$node->expr->name->parts[0] === 'define'
) {
$fullyQualifiedName = $node->expr->args[0]->value->value;
return $this->count('constants', $fullyQualifiedName)
&& !defined($fullyQualifiedName);
}
}
if (($this->needsDocumentedGlobals || $this->needsUndocumentedGlobals)
&& !$this->isInIf // Don't keep conditionally declared globals.
&& $node instanceof Expression
&& $node->expr instanceof Assign
&& $node->expr->var instanceof Variable
&& is_string($node->expr->var->name)
) {
$this->count('globals', $node->expr->var->name);
// We'll keep regular global variable declarations, depending on
// whether or not they are documented.
if ($node->getDocComment()) {
return $this->needsDocumentedGlobals;
} else {
return $this->needsUndocumentedGlobals;
}
}
return false;
}
/**
* Keeps a count of declarations by type and name of node.
*
* @param string $type One of `array_keys($this->counts)`.
* @param string|null $name Name of the node. Theoretically could be null.
*
* @return bool If true, this is the first declaration of this type with
* this name, so it can be safely included.
*/
private function count(string $type, string $name = null): bool
{
assert(isset($this->counts[$type]), 'Expected valid `$type`');
if (!$name) {
return false;
}
return ($this->counts[$type][$name] = ($this->counts[$type][$name] ?? 0) + 1) === 1;
}
/**
* Populates the `classLikeNamespaces` property with namespaces with classes
* declared in a valid order.
*
* @param ClassLikeWithDependencies $clwd
* @return void
*/
private function resolveClassLike(ClassLikeWithDependencies $clwd): void
{
if (isset($this->resolvedClassLikes[$clwd->fullyQualifiedName])) {
// Already resolved.
return;
}
$this->resolvedClassLikes[$clwd->fullyQualifiedName] = true;
foreach ($clwd->dependencies as $dependencyName) {
if (isset($this->classLikes[$dependencyName])) {
$this->resolveClassLike($this->classLikes[$dependencyName]);
}
}
if (!$this->currentClassLikeNamespace) {
$namespaceMatches = false;
} elseif ($this->currentClassLikeNamespace->name) {
$namespaceMatches = $this->currentClassLikeNamespace->name->toString() === $clwd->namespace;
} else {
$namespaceMatches = !$clwd->namespace;
}
// Reduntant check to make Psalm happy.
if ($this->currentClassLikeNamespace && $namespaceMatches) {
$this->currentClassLikeNamespace->stmts[] = $clwd->node;
} else {
$name = $clwd->namespace ? new Name($clwd->namespace) : null;
$this->currentClassLikeNamespace = new Namespace_($name, [$clwd->node]);
$this->classLikeNamespaces[] = $this->currentClassLikeNamespace;
}
}
/**
* Determines if each namespace in the list is a global namespace.
*
* @param Namespace_[] $namespaces
* @return bool
*/
private function allAreGlobal(array $namespaces): bool
{
foreach ($namespaces as $namespace) {
if ($namespace->name && $namespace->name->toString() !== '') {
return false;
}
}
return true;
}
/**
* Merges the statements of each namespace into one array.
*
* @param Namespace_[] $namespaces
* @return Stmt[]
*/
private function reduceStmts(array $namespaces): array
{
$stmts = [];
foreach ($namespaces as $namespace) {
foreach ($namespace->stmts as $stmt) {
$stmts[] = $stmt;
}
}
return $stmts;
}
}
